Care tips

  • Allow the hotplate to cool before cleaning.
  • Wipe the cooking surface with a soft damp cloth after use.
  • Avoid abrasive cleaners or scouring pads that may scratch the surface.
  • Keep the appliance dry and avoid immersing electrical parts in water.
  • Use flat, induction-compatible cookware and follow the individual product instructions for safe operation.

What cookware works with an Award induction hotplate?
Use magnetic cookware such as many stainless steel and cast iron pots and pans. If a magnet sticks firmly to the base, the cookware is likely suitable for induction.
